NSV: Day 3 Smoke Free - no bad food choices. Love my band!

I can't lie...quitting smoking using Chantix is a breeze. I've hardly had any cravings and when they do, they go away about as fast as they came about. The first day was tough, I wanted to have something hand-to-mouth like I have done for longer than I'd care to mention. Day 2: I decided to go buy up as many healthy Snacks and chewing gum (usually a no-no for bandsters) as I could get my hands on. It helped a lot to nibble on seeds, nuts, fruit and Cereal bars when the cravings hit me. But today, I don't even feel the need for all of that...I'm happy I have a cabinet full of goodies here in my office, but the band is still keeping me from wanting too much food! I thought I would need to go and buy celery and carrots to cut into cig sized sticks today, but I seem to be doing alright so far. What an added blessing! Anyway, I'm staying strong and I believe I will stay smoke free using Chantix and I shouldn't gain too much that I can't get back off quickly since I have the band.

*Chewing gum is not advised for bandsters, even if you don't swallow, small pieces can still go down your throat. If you notice difficulty eating or drinking after you have chewed gum, drink a bit of vegetable or olive oil. This will break down the gum base and allow it to slide through your stoma.
